Anil Kapoor film with Anees Bazmee
Anil Kapoor starred in Anees Bazmee's direction No Entry, released in 2005. The classic comedy release, produced by Boney Kapoor, starred Anil Kapoor, Salman Khan, Fardeen Khan, Bipasha Basu, Esha Deol, Lara Dutta, Celina Jaitly. The film became a blockbuster release, earning Rs 70 crore worldwide. Now, the sequel, No Entry 2, is in talks. Producer Boney Kapoor has confirmed Diljit Dosanjh's exit while also speaking about Varun Dhawan and Arjun Kapoor as confirmed cast. In an interview with NDTV, filmmaker had mentioned, "Yes, we have parted in good spirits as the dates were not aligning with our requirements. Hopefully, we will soon do a Punjabi film together.” Meanwhile while talking to us, Boney Kapoor had slammed the rumours of Varun and Arjun's exit as he said, "We are making No Entry Mein Entry, and Varun and Arjun are very much in the film.
